I have purchased mine from crow, I was a bit hesitant to do so as last cam I purchased from crow had casting dags all over it which caused it to fowl on the 200 rods in a crossflow. Not only that the radius on the bearing journals where jagged as if the cutter/grinder was skipping.

Anyway I purchased the ovate with moly retainers and some have 1mm difference in free height.

It's ok as I will be adjusting seat pressure with shims anyway but pretty poor considering they are suppose to be a quality product.

I was originally going to use a v8 set of comp cams springs which where dearer than the crow but cheaper than atomic.

And I would have 8 spares.

I could of picked the best matched having the extras.
